What is the potential energy of 2.14 kg book that is an bookshelf 1.0m above the floor

The potential energy of an object is given by the equation:
Potential Energy = mass * gravitational acceleration * height
Given:
mass = 2.14 kg
height = 1.0 m
gravitational acceleration is approximately 9.8 m/s^2
Potential Energy = 2.14 kg * 9.8 m/s^2 * 1.0 m
Potential Energy = 20.972 J (rounded to three decimal places)
Therefore, the potential energy of the 2.14 kg book that is 1.0 m above the floor is approximately 20.972 Joules.
